The official dates for private-to-fiscal transfers in Ecuador's Costa-Galápagos region for the 2026-2027 school year begin on March 24, 2026, with the online process running through late April via the Ministry of Education's Juntos platform at juntos.educacion.gob.ec. This covers transitions from private to public fiscal schools, prioritizing siblings first, followed by general students, with specific windows for each grade level and transfer type.

Step-by-Step Process

To execute a traslado de particular a fiscal, representatives must follow this numbered sequence on the Juntos platform. The system uses geolocation to match students to nearby schools with available cupos, ensuring equity.

  1. Register or log in at juntos.educacion.gob.ec starting March 24, 2026, using your national ID.
  2. Upload required documents: birth certificate, current private school certification, and vaccination record.
  3. Select up to three preferred fiscal institutions; algorithm prioritizes domicile within 2km radius.
  4. Track status daily; approvals notify via SMS and email within 72 hours.
  5. Print the digital matricula certificate by April 30 for orientation sessions in May.

Eligibility Requirements

Students transitioning from particular schools to fiscal ones must meet strict criteria set by the Ministry. Ecuador saw a 22% surge in such requests in 2025, driven by economic pressures on families averaging $450 monthly private fees.

  • Current private enrollment proof (boleta 2025-2026).
  • Domicile within the fiscal school's zone (verified via CNE registry).
  • No disciplinary sanctions in prior two years.
  • Complete vaccination card per MSP standards.
  • Priority for low-income via BU voucher holders (65% of approvals).

What documents are mandatory for traslados?

Certified birth certificate, private school withdrawal letter, ID copies of parents/guardian, and updated vaccination record. Upload scans under 2MB each; platform rejects oversized files automatically.

When does the school year start?

The 2026-2027 lectivo begins May 15 in Costa-Galápagos, with orientation May 1-14 for new transfers. Delays affect only 3% due to late certificates.

Can I transfer mid-year?

No mid-year traslados allowed; all must occur in this March-April window. Exceptions for extreme cases (health/relocation) require MinEduc approval, granted in 7% of 2025 petitions.

Is there priority for siblings?

Yes, March 24-31 exclusively for hermanos, securing 120,000 spots nationwide in 2025-essential for family cohesion.

What if cupos are full?

Waitlist activates April 16; 25% of waitlisters got spots last year via dropouts. Alternative fiscals suggested automatically.

How to track application status?

Login daily to Juntos dashboard; SMS alerts for updates. 89% resolved pre-April 15 in prior cycles.

Are there fees?

100% gratuitous; any solicited payments are fraud-report to MinEduc hotline.
